Reggae Boyz need depth

Reggae Boyz assistant coach Alfredo Montesso believes the current squad could use some freshening up and that it is important for the team to increase their depth ahead of next year's FIFA World Cup Qualifiers.
For the last couple of months, the team has consisted of the same basic core of players, who had an outstanding performance at the CONCACAF Gold Cup but have since failed to win their last three matches.

"We have to understand that we need to increase our options, we have to increase our core of players because of injuries and also football is played in moments, sometimes it is working for you sometimes it is not, so you have to increase the numbers," Montesso told Star Sports.
The need to strengthen the Reggae Boyz squad has led to the call-up of three England-based professionals, Bristol City's Marvin Elliot, Brentford's Marcus Bean and Chesterfield's Nathan Smith. England-based professionals being included in the national squad proved a key factor of the national team's historical debut at the 1998 World Cup in France but have at times proved a tricky issue for national coaches.

However, while the team has lost their last four games, Montesso is not over concerned and insists that it is a necessary part of the building process.

"We have to understand that now we are building the team, Theodore (Whitmore) is getting some new players in now, we discussed bringing some new players from England to change the team a little bit," Montesso said.

"We cannot use the qualifiers to test players or build a team, these hard games Colombia, Ecuador and Honduras, who we will play soon will give us a good test and the opportunity to build the team."

Jamaica, currently ranked 45th will next be in action when they face Honduras on Tuesday, October 11.
